An approximate wave solution of order two of Einstein's theory of gravitation coupled with a Higgs field is presented using the multiple-scale method. The characteristic (eikonal) equation as well as propagation and back-reaction equations are investigated in the Lorentz-gauge on a spherically symmetric background. From the constraint equations it is found that the initial high-frequency perturbation has a significant influence on the formation of trapped surfaces. A numerical solution of the equations is presented using a finite-element collocation method.
